Transaction 10abf72f01228d09fe7ecf45bc86ec07cef5c54a2f608fe869c5072beb663b80

1 Input
2 Outputs
  • 10abf72f01228d09fe7ecf45bc86ec07cef5c54a2f608fe869c5072beb663b80:0
  • value  617700
    address  3E8TN3udoet6C7RKQVwLKNoU23T9jBECfo
  • 10abf72f01228d09fe7ecf45bc86ec07cef5c54a2f608fe869c5072beb663b80:1
  • value  149543415
    address  3FeQTso64EnMc4WaMsaEDnt6LttuiJbSMo